Ozone Treatment
Starting at $50
Ozone treatment is one of the most effective ways to eliminate persistent odors in a vehicle. The process neutralizes odor-causing particles at a molecular level, tackling smells that regular cleaning cannot fully remove, including smoke, mildew, and pet odors.

What Sets a Professional Interior Detail Apart
Deep Cleaning
We get into the areas that standard cleaning misses, including vents, crevices, seat tracks, and door pockets, so the entire cabin feels genuinely clean, not just surface-level tidy.
Fabric and Leather Care
Whether your seats are cloth or leather, we use the right products and techniques for each material. Cloth is shampooed to lift stains and odors, while leather is cleaned and conditioned to keep it soft and prevent cracking.
Odor Elimination
Masking an odor is not the same as removing it. Our cleaning process targets the source of smells at the fabric and surface level, and we offer ozone treatment as an add-on for persistent odors that need a deeper solution.
Glass and Trim
Interior glass is cleaned streak-free, and all trim and plastics are wiped down and dressed where appropriate. The result is a cabin that looks sharp from every angle.
How Often Should You Have Your Interior Detailed?
The right frequency depends on how you use your vehicle, but a good general rule is every three to six months for most drivers. That said, certain situations call for more frequent attention.
You Have Kids or Pets
Families with children or pets tend to accumulate messes quickly. Food, pet hair, and tracked-in dirt can build up fast and start to affect the feel of the cabin. More frequent detailing keeps things manageable and prevents stains from setting in permanently.
You Use Your Vehicle for Work
If your vehicle doubles as a workspace or you spend a lot of time in it, it tends to show wear faster. Regular interior detailing keeps it looking professional and presentable, which matters whether you are picking up clients or just taking pride in your space.
You Are Preparing to Sell
A clean, well-maintained interior makes a strong impression on potential buyers and can meaningfully impact what your vehicle is worth. Getting a professional detail before listing is one of the simplest ways to increase perceived value.
Your Interior Has a Noticeable Odor
If you notice a persistent smell in your vehicle, it is worth addressing sooner rather than later. Odors that have had time to settle into fabric and carpet become much harder to remove. An interior detail, paired with an ozone treatment if needed, can make a significant difference.
